Dashboard
Blocks
Transactions
Explorer API
Address
1EkZRLLtJaUz3Jj3qsGe7JRd3tFNkFyKXx
Confirmed tx count
26
Confirmed received
13 outputs (1.49860994 BTC)
Confirmed spent
13 outputs (1.49860994 BTC)
Confirmed unspent
No outputs
25-26 of 26 Transactions
f628c2aea2932a341b851a0a37939c81476975064faacffdb64fee32f1d19a3b
Details
589cd2ef5834a6b6e74b123b03256026afba0e1a3312b543b153afc7a4731c89:0
0.23926744 BTC
1EkZRLLtJaUz3Jj3qsGe7JRd3tFNkFyKXx
0.05000000 BTC
1GfchiP7qZ5oi3nwbLvtMz4bfvuc5LraNS
0.18916744 BTC
Newer